Fig. 8. Arp2/3 complex mutants show typical actin patch-associated phenotypes.

Fig. 8

A. Plate spotting assays were done as described in Fig. 1 legend. Arp2/3 complex mutants show similar cell wall and cell membrane defects as well as salt sensitivity as previously described for myo5Δ/Δ mutants.

B. Arp2/3 complex mutants showed aberrant cell wall deposition, indicating defects in cell separation (arrows). See also movie 2 (Supporting information) with arp2Δ/Δ cells that show cell separation defects. Logarithmically growing cells were stained with CFW directly in YPD media for 5 min, washed and visualized. Bar = 10 μm.
